Microbiome engineering and plant biostimulants for sustainable crop improvement and mitigation of biotic and abiotic stresses

Globally, despite the intense agricultural production, the output is expected to be limited by emerging infectious plant diseases and adverse impacts of climate change. The annual increase in agricultural output to sustain the human population at the expense of the environment has exacerbated the current climate conditions and threatened food security. The demand for sustainable agricultural practice is further augmented with the exclusion of synthetic fertilizers and pesticides. Therefore, the application of plant microbiome engineering and (natural) biostimulants has been at the forefront as an environment-friendly approach to enhance crop production and increase crop tolerance to adverse environmental conditions. In this article, we explore the application of microbiome engineering and plant biostimulants as a sustainable approach to mitigating biotic and abiotic stresses and improving nutrient use efficiency to promote plant growth and increase crop yield. The advancement/understanding in plant-biostimulant interaction relies on the current scientific research to elucidate the extent of benefits conferred by these biostimulants under adverse conditions.
